Aflatoxin poisoning is a MAJOR health issue in eastern China, especially

Jiangsu province.

Ochratoxin A is also very well known in northern and eastern Europe, because

people eat foods that are contaminated with it, both grains, and also meat

from animals that were fed contaminated grain.

I would be extremely surprised if it did not occur in the US. The place to

find out would be PubMed, not the media.
